Professional technicians will check your engine, brakes, tires, and suspension systems to confirm everything is functioning as it should. Fluids are another critical factor—engine oil, brake fluid, transmission fluid, and coolant all need to be topped off and checked for leaks. Florida’s heat can be intense, so ensuring your cooling system is in great condition will help prevent overheating on the road.

Tires should also be a top priority. Inspect them for proper air pressure, even tread wear, and any damage that could lead to blowouts or poor handling. Don’t forget to check alignment and suspension—driving long distances with a vehicle that pulls to one side or rides roughly can be both exhausting and unsafe.

Battery health is another important area to review before your trip. Road trips often involve extended use of electronics like GPS, music systems, and air conditioning, which can put extra demands on your car’s electrical system. Speaking of air conditioning, Florida’s heat and humidity make it essential to have a system that keeps the cabin comfortable for the entire journey.

Brakes, headlights, brake lights, and turn signals should all be inspected to ensure maximum safety, especially for nighttime driving or sudden rainstorms. Replacing windshield wipers before your trip is also a smart move so you’re prepared for Florida’s unpredictable summer showers.

Finally, don’t forget to pack essential items like a spare tire, jack, jumper cables, an emergency kit, and extra water. These basics can make a big difference if you encounter unexpected issues along the way and will give you peace of mind throughout your journey.
